RE: Anyone know where i can find a painted prop spinner?
Sand the spinner lightly to provide some tooth. Paint the whole spinner with your light color; let dry. Cut a strip of electrical tape the width of your light color spacing, start at the tip and carefully wind the tape to the top. paint the darker color. I use acrilic latex paint and top coat it with mineral based varathane spray poly. Let the poly cure for a couple of weeks befor using an electric starter. Good luck.
If you can find a spinner in one of the colors this gets easier.
